[member=74278]Packard[/member] - the WP drill guide features Teflon bushings. Also, since you're new to this discussion I encourage you to read back through the thread to understand the baseline beefs that folks have had with pretty much every low and modestly priced drill guide (at least until the Taiwanese version that's being marketed with improvements by UJK/Axminster &, most recently, Rocker), the lack of precision in the interface between the guide rod and the drill bracket being perhaps the foremost. For precision work, there can't be any slop here. But, again, before the advent of the UJK/Rocker versions, slop was all we had available to is. Now, the WP's version appears to have taken this to an even higher level. Given the closeness in pricing between the WP and Rockler offerings, I am happy to forgoe the ability to the tilt the guide rods (for angled drilling) in exchange for a domestically produced precision tool. I figure that I'll be able to achieve the same functionality (angled drilling) using jigs, assuming I'll be able to countersink some holes into the base to facilitate jig making.
